Guest House Remodeling in Denver County, CO
Guest house remodeling services involve updating and customizing existing guest accommodations to better suit the needs and preferences of homeowners. These projects can include interior renovations such as kitchen and bathroom upgrades, flooring replacements, or painting, as well as exterior improvements like siding, roofing, and landscaping enhancements. Property owners often seek these services to improve comfort, increase property value, or create a more functional space for visitors, family members, or rental purposes.
Before requesting guest house remodeling, property owners typically want to understand the scope of work, including design options, material choices, and potential impacts on existing structures. Clarifying budget considerations, project timelines, and any necessary permits or approvals can also help ensure a smooth renovation process. Having clear expectations about the desired outcomes and the overall renovation plan supports a successful transformation of the guest house space.

Common Guest House Remodeling Jobs
Guest House Renovations - updating and modernizing existing guest accommodations for comfort and style.
Interior Remodeling - redesigning guest house interiors to improve layout and functionality.
Exterior Enhancements - improving curb appeal through siding, roofing, and outdoor features.
Bathroom and Kitchen Updates - upgrading fixtures, cabinets, and surfaces for better usability.
Structural Improvements - reinforcing foundations and framing to ensure safety and durability.
Energy Efficiency Upgrades - installing insulation, windows, and systems to reduce energy use.
